The vision of William concerning Piers the Plowman, together with Vita de Dowel, Dobet, et Dobest, secundum Wit et Resoun, by William Langland (about 1362-1393 A. D.)

Home in-to his owen erthe · and halde hym þer euere— [erthe] erd S; ȝerde I. þer euere] þerinne I.] "For ich am wel awreke · of wastours þorw þy myghte. [For] I om. awreke] awroke I. of] on M.] Ac ich praye þe," quaþ peers · "hunger, er þow wende, Of beggers and of bydders · what best be to done? [and of] and IM. best be] be best S; is best M.] Line 210 For ich wot wel, be þou went · worche þei wolle ful ylle; [B page 104] [þou] hungur I.] Meschief hit makeþ · thei ben so meke nouthe, Line 212 And for defaute þis folke · folwen my hestes. Hit is no þyng for loue · thei labour þus faste, [no—loue] noght for loue, leue it I. thei] þat þey S.] Bote for fere of famyn · in faith," seide peers; "Ys no final loue with þis folke · for al here faire speche; [Ys] Þer is IM. final] so PG; fynel E; feyþful S; filial I; lel M. with] wit P.] Line 216 And hit [ben] my blody broþren · for god bouhte vs alle. [hit] þei M. [ben EM] beþ S; aren PG; are I; see l. 52.] Treuthe tauhte me ones · to louye hem echone, And helpen hem of alle þyng · ay as hem nedeþ. [helpen] to helpe I. ay] euere M.] Now wolde ich wite, or þow wentest · what were þe beste, [wolde ich] y wulde S. wite] white P. wentest] wendist I. what] wat P.] Line 220 How ich myghte a-maistren hem · to louye and laboure [and] and to IM.] For here lyflode; · lere me, syre hunger." [lyflode] owne liflode S. lere] lern M. me] me now I.] "Now herkne," quaþ hunger · "and hold hit for a wysdome; [A page 85] Bolde beggeres and bygge · þat mowe here bred by|swynke, [Bolde] And bolde P; but IMSEG omit And. and bygge] þat begge I.] Line 224 With houndes bred and hors-bred · hele hem when þei hungren, And a-bane hem with benes · for bollynge of here wombe. [And] ISG om. bollynge] bolnyng M. wombe] wombes M.]
